Elevate Your Home Gym: Necessary Equipment for a Complete Workout


Creating a home gym has become a popular choice for fitness enthusiasts who desire the benefit of working out without leaving their homes. The ideal equipment can change any area into a practical and efficient workout area. In this article, we will explore some important equipment for your home gym, ensuring you have everything you require to accomplish your fitness goals.

Olympic Barbell: The Core of Strength Training

An Olympic barbell is a staple in any serious home gym. Known for its versatility and durability, the Olympic barbell is utilized for a range of exercises, including squats, deadlifts, and bench presses. Its robust construction can handle heavy weights, making it perfect for those who intend to build strength and muscle mass. When selecting an Olympic barbell, search for one with a great knurling pattern for a secure grip and a weight capacity that matches your lifting objectives.

Cardio Machines: Enhancing Your Endurance

Cardio machines are important for improving cardiovascular health and endurance. A treadmill, for instance, is best for walking, running, and running, offering a versatile method to get your heart rate up. For a lower effect workout, an elliptical machine offers a smooth and joint-friendly alternative. Both makers can be adapted to fit different fitness levels and are equipped with numerous programs to keep your workouts fascinating and challenging.

Treadmill: The Classic Cardio Staple

A treadmill is a fantastic addition to any home gym, using a vast array of advantages. Whether you prefer strolling, running, or running, a treadmill allows you to exercise inside despite the weather. Modern treadmills feature advanced features such as adjustable slopes, integrated workout programs, and even virtual running experiences that simulate various terrains. These functions help you remain motivated and engaged while working towards your fitness objectives.

Elliptical: Low-Impact, High-Intensity

An elliptical machine provides an exceptional cardio workout without the effect on your joints that running can cause. This makes it a perfect option for those with joint problems or anyone trying to find a gentler workout. Ellipticals are equipped with handlebars that move in sync with the pedals, permitting you to engage your upper body as well. This full-body workout can assist improve total cardiovascular fitness and tone various muscle groups.

Bumper Plates: Safe and Effective Weightlifting

Bumper plates are necessary for anyone severe about weightlifting. Made from thick rubber, these plates are designed to be dropped from a height without harming your flooring or the plates themselves. This makes them ideal for workouts like deadlifts, power cleans, and snatches. Bumper plates can be found in various weights and are color-coded for simple recognition. Purchasing an excellent set of bumper plates ensures you can safely carry out Olympic Barbell heavy lifts at home.

Deadlift Platform: Protecting Your Space

A deadlift platform is an important addition to any home gym, specifically if you plan on raising heavy weights. This platform supplies a designated area for deadlifts, safeguarding your floorings from damage and reducing noise. It likewise uses a stable surface that can assist enhance your lifting performance. Search for a platform that is durable and supplies appropriate cushioning to absorb the effect of dropped weights.

Weightlifting Set: Comprehensive Strength Training

A weightlifting set is an all-in-one option for those looking to build muscle and strength. These sets generally consist of an Olympic barbell, a range of weight plates, and sometimes additional accessories like collars and raising straps. Having a total weightlifting set at home permits you to perform a wide variety of workouts, from squats and deadlifts to bench presses and overhead lifts. This adaptability makes it much easier to stick to an extensive strength training regimen.

Air Rower: Full-Body Cardio

An air rower is an exceptional piece of cardio equipment that supplies a full-body workout. Rowing engages your legs, core, and upper body, making it an efficient way to burn calories and enhance cardiovascular fitness. The resistance on an air rower is generated by a flywheel, which implies the more difficult you row, the higher the resistance. This permits you to manage the strength of your workout, making it suitable for all fitness levels.

Air Ski: Unique and Challenging

The air ski machine is a relatively new addition to the world of cardio equipment but has quickly acquired popularity for its distinct and difficult workout. This machine replicates the movement of cross-country snowboarding, engaging both your upper and lower body. It's an exceptional method to enhance cardiovascular endurance and build muscle. The air ski is likewise low-impact, making it ideal for individuals with joint issues.

Air Bike: High-Intensity Cardio

An air bike, likewise called an attack bike, is developed for high-intensity period training (HIIT). The resistance on an air bike is created by a fan, so the more difficult you pedal, the higher the resistance. This makes it an outstanding tool for those seeking to enhance their cardiovascular fitness and burn a considerable number of calories in a short amount of time. Air bikes likewise engage both your upper and lower body, supplying a thorough workout.
